tests/auto/qaccessibility/tst_qaccessibility.cpp
changeset 19 fcece45ef507
parent 18 2f34d5167611
child 33 3e2da88830cd
equal deleted inserted replaced
18:2f34d5167611 19:fcece45ef507
  3921     QAccessibleInterface *acc = QAccessible::queryAccessibleInterface(w);
  3921     QAccessibleInterface *acc = QAccessible::queryAccessibleInterface(w);
  3922     delete acc;
  3922     delete acc;
  3923 
  3923 
  3924     acc = QAccessible::queryAccessibleInterface(cb);
  3924     acc = QAccessible::queryAccessibleInterface(cb);
  3925 
  3925 
  3926     QRect accRect = acc->rect(0);
       
  3927     for (int i = 1; i < acc->childCount(); ++i) {
  3926     for (int i = 1; i < acc->childCount(); ++i) {
  3928         QVERIFY(accRect.contains(acc->rect(i)));
  3927         QTRY_VERIFY(acc->rect(0).contains(acc->rect(i)));
  3929     }
  3928     }
  3930     QCOMPARE(acc->doAction(QAccessible::Press, 2), true);
  3929     QCOMPARE(acc->doAction(QAccessible::Press, 2), true);
  3931     QTest::qWait(400);
  3930     QTest::qWait(400);
  3932     QAccessibleInterface *accList = 0;
  3931     QAccessibleInterface *accList = 0;
  3933     int entry = acc->navigate(QAccessible::Child, 3, &accList);
  3932     int entry = acc->navigate(QAccessible::Child, 3, &accList);